On 25 Oct 1632 Charles Dormer 2nd Earl Carnarvon was born to Robert Dormer 1st Earl Carnarvon (age 22) and Anne Sophia Herbert Countess Carnarvon.
Archaeologia Volume 13 Section XXV. From the Baptisms is this entry.
"The lord Dormer, viscount Askot, eldest son to the right honourable the earl of Carnarvon (age 22), was born on Fryday Oct. 25, and christened [Note. at St Benet's Church, Paul's Wharf [Map]] on Tuesday November 26, 1632."
Robert Dormer (age 22), baron Dormer of Winge, and baronet, was created by king Charles I. viscount Ascot, and earl of Caernarvon, August 2, 1628. This nobleman, alike distnguished for his virtue, wisdom, and valour, fell after the battle of Newberry, Sept. 20, 1643, in his return from pursuing a party of the parliamentary forces, being killed by a trooper, who, knowing his lordship, ran, him through the body with a sword, and he expired in about an hour. He married Anna-Sophia, daughter of Philip (age 48), earl of Pembroke and Montgomery, by whom he had an only child, whose birth and baptism are mentioned above. He was William [Note. A mistake for Charles?], the second earl of Caernarvon, who dying November 29, 1709, without male issue, that title became extinct, but the barony descended to the issue of Anthony Dormer, of Grove Park, in Warwickshire, second son of Robert, the first lord Dormer; but after being possessed by Robert [Note. Rowland?], the eldest son of that Anthony, it went to the issue male of Robert, the third son of the first baron, and is still posssessed by that branch.

Pepy's Diary. 05 May 1667. We talked of Tangier, of which he is ashamed; also that it should put the King (age 36) to this charge for no good in the world: and now a man going over that is a good soldier, but a debauched man, which the place need not to have. And so used these words: "That this place was to the King (age 36) as my Lord Carnarvon (age 34) says of wood, that it is an excrescence of the earth provided by God for the payment of debts".
